What are Zero Coupon securities ?

CATS (Certificates of Accrual on Treasury Securities)are Issues from the U.S. Treasury sold at a deep discount from their face value. They are called Zero Coupon securities because they require no interest payments during their lifetime, but they return the full face value at maturity. They cannot be called away.
